
Vegetarian Stir Fry with Burgers

A delicious vegetarian stir fry topped with strips of Quorn Southern Fried burgers for a twist on this simple and well-loved dish. Super easy to cook and made in no time. So wok are you waiting for? Time to get cooking!

Serves 2
20 mins
Easy
383 cals
(Per serving)
13.2g of fat
(Per serving)

Ingredients
- 164g Quorn Southern Fried Burgers
- 300-350g cooked rice noodles
- 50g sugar snap peas
- 1 green pepper
- 30g kale
- 1 green chilli
- Sesame oil, to fry in
- Salt
- Black sesame seeds
To serve:
- Sweet chili sauce
Method
- Prepare the Quorn Southern Fried Burgers according to the instructions on the package. Cut into strips and set aside.
- Slice the peppers and finely chop the chilli. Heat a pan with a little oil. Add sugar snap peas, peppers and kale. Add chilli to taste and fry everything for a couple of minutes. Sprinkle with a pinch of salt.
- Top cooked rice noodles with stir-fried vegetables. Top with the burger strips and sesame seeds. Serve with sweet chilli sauce and enjoy!
